Returned Demo Units — Runbook 4.2

When demo units come back from the Varnhold roadshow, log each serial in the Tilbury sheet, wipe the firmware, and repack in grey crates only. Crates go to the staging shelf by Thursday noon. Quill Logistics collects every Friday morning. Before release, confirm the manifest is signed by the duty lead.

handover note for tadug-yaguf: the aldath pelwyn courier leaves the casox norwyn briix silok zorok kasdor aldion quenox ledger at gate 2653 under passcode 959015

// Importer for the Marrowgate Library catalogue feed. Each nightly run pulls
// record batches from the consortium export, normalizes MARC-ish fields, and
// upserts into the catalogue store. Batching is deliberately conservative:
// oversized batches caused lock contention during the Fennel Hill migration,
// and retry storms overwhelmed the dedup stage. Please review changes to these
// values at the weekly eng sync before merging, since they interact with the
// overnight indexing window. The current tuning constants follow.

tuning constants:
QUOTAS = {
    "druwyn": 5,
    "holix": 5,
    "zorath": 5,
    "holwyn": 10,
}

## Tailing Production Logs with `lgtail`

Support staff can stream live logs from the Quillport gateway using the internal `lgtail` CLI. Run `lgtail --env prod --service quillport` to begin tailing; add `--filter error` to reduce noise. Sessions auto-expire after 30 minutes to limit load on the aggregator. If the stream stalls, restart with the `--fresh` flag rather than reconnecting.

Authentication is required before any tail command will run. Use the service key below when prompted.

API key for yahig-tadup: kto7_ubizbYm